Regulation of Medical Devices in Helsinki, Finland

Helsinki, the capital city of Finland, is known for its advanced healthcare system and cutting-edge Medical technologies. The Regulation of medical devices in Helsinki is governed by both national and European Union laws to ensure the safety, effectiveness, and quality of these products. In this blog post, we will delve into the regulatory framework for medical devices in Helsinki, Finland. In Finland, medical devices are regulated by the Finnish Medicines Agency (Fimea) and the National Supervisory Authority for Welfare and Health (Valvira). Fimea is responsible for the pre-market approval and surveillance of medical devices, while Valvira oversees post-market surveillance and enforcement activities. These agencies work in close collaboration with other European Union member states through the European regulatory network to ensure harmonized regulations across the EU. Medical devices are categorized into different classes based on the level of risk they pose to patients and users. Class I devices, such as bandages and stethoscopes, are low-risk products that are subject to general safety requirements. Class IIa, IIb, and III devices, which include items like pacemakers and artificial joints, are subject to stricter regulations and may require clinical data to demonstrate their safety and effectiveness. Before a medical device can be placed on the market in Helsinki, it must undergo a thorough conformity assessment to ensure that it meets the essential requirements outlined in the EU Medical Devices Regulation (MDR). This assessment includes an evaluation of the device's design, performance, and labeling, as well as the manufacturer's quality management system. Once a device has been CE marked, indicating compliance with the regulatory requirements, it can be distributed and used within the European Union, including Helsinki. Post-market surveillance is crucial to monitor the performance of medical devices once they are on the market. Manufacturers, authorized representatives, and healthcare providers are required to report any incidents or malfunctions related to medical devices to the competent authorities. Valvira is responsible for coordinating post-market surveillance activities in Finland and taking action to address any safety concerns that may arise. In conclusion, the regulation of medical devices in Helsinki, Finland, is based on a comprehensive framework that prioritizes patient safety and public health. By ensuring compliance with stringent regulatory requirements, Helsinki continues to be a hub for innovation and excellence in the field of medical technology. The collaboration between national and EU regulatory bodies plays a crucial role in maintaining the high standards of quality and safety for medical devices in the region.
